The global extension problem, co-flag and metabelian Leibniz algebras
Abstract
Let be a Leibniz algebra, a vector space and an epimorphism of vector spaces with . The global extension problem asks for the classification of all Leibniz algebra structures that can be defined on such that is a morphism of Leibniz algebras: from a geometrical viewpoint this means to give the decomposition of the groupoid of all such structures in its connected components and to indicate a point in each component. All such Leibniz algebra structures on are classified by a global cohomological object which is explicitly constructed. It is shown that is the coproduct of all local cohomological objects that are classifying sets for all extensions of by all Leibniz algebra structures on . The second cohomology group of Loday and Pirashvili appears as the most elementary piece among all components of . Several examples are worked out in details for co-flag Leibniz algebras over , i.e. Leibniz algebras that have a finite chain of epimorphisms of Leibniz algebras such that , for all .
